Fresh & EasyComparing Key Nutrients
| Nutrient | Three Cheese... | Whole Grain ... |
|---|---|---|
| Carbs | 31.0g | 41.0g |
| Sugars | 2.0g | 2.0g |
| Fiber | 4.0g | 4.0g |
| Protein | 8.0g | 7.0g |
| Fat | 7.0g | 1.0g |

The key difference is in their blood sugar impact: Three Cheese Tortellini, Three Cheese has a BSI of 51.5 while Whole Grain Pasta has a BSI of 72.0. Three Cheese Tortellini, Three Cheese has the lower blood sugar impact, making it potentially better for blood glucose management.
Three Cheese Tortellini, Three Cheese appears to be the better choice for diabetics with a lower BSI score of 51.5. However, consider your individual response, portion sizes, and overall meal composition when making food choices.
Three Cheese Tortellini, Three Cheese contains 55.4g of carbohydrates per 100g, while Whole Grain Pasta contains 73.2g per 100g. Three Cheese Tortellini, Three Cheese has 17.9g fewer carbs, which may result in less blood sugar impact.
Three Cheese Tortellini, Three Cheese provides 7.1g of fiber per 100g, compared to 7.1g in Whole Grain Pasta. Both foods provide similar amounts of fiber.
